Ghizer District is a district of the Pakistan-administered Gilgit-Baltistan region in the disputed Kashmir region. Less than 13.5% of the district consists of alpine pastures, with over 83% of remaining area being barren or permanently snow covered.

The best months to visit Ghizer are May, June, July, August, September. During these months the weather is most favourable for sightseeing and outdoor activities.
